How to answer ‘tell me about yourself'. Harvard’s golden tips

Most interviews start with “Tell me about yourself.” It sounds simple, but it’s your chance to make a strong first impression.

“Tell me about yourself” seems like a friendly question, but it’s open-ended and tricky to answer well.

Should you talk about your life, your last job, or your hobbies?

If you’re in the room, you’re already qualified. Now, it’s about showing that you’re the right match.

Read the job description and highlight what’s “required”, “must have”, or “highly desired”.

Start with “I’m someone who…” or “At work, my approach is…”, then give a real example that shows you’ve done similar work before.

Pick a story from your past job that matches their role. Show how you solved problems or added value.

Practise your answer before the interview. Keep it short, confident, and focused on meeting their needs.
